PENGANTAR PEMROGRAMAN BAHASAS C++
Pendahuluan
Bahasa Pemrograman C++ dikembangkan oleg AT&T Bell Laboratories pada awal tahun 1980 Oleh Bjarne Troustrup. Bahasa C++ merupakan evolusi dari bahasa C
Tambahan-tambahan terhadap bahasa C
1. Fasilitas untuk membuat dan menggunakan abstraksi-abstraksi data.
2. Fasilitas untuk desain dan pemrograman berorientasi objek
3. Macam-macam perbaikan terhadap fasilitas yang telah ada pada bahasa C.
1.2 Struktur program bahasa C
Sebelum belajar lebih jauh tentang struktur pemrograman bahasa C++, mari kita pelajari dulu struktur bahasa C. Struktur bahasa C terdiri dari dari beberapa blok seperti di bawah.
1. Header Files Header files mengadung informasi yang diperlukan untuk libraries. Untuk mengakses variabel atau fungsi yang didefinisikan dalam standard libraries.
2. Variabel Global
Variabel global adalah variabel yang dideklarasikan diluar blok program
utama dan blok fungsi-fungsi, bertujuan agar variabel tersebut dikenali oleh
baik pada blok program utama maupun blok fungsi-fungsi.
3. Prototype Fungsi-fungsi
Agar fungsi dapat dikenali oleh program utama dan fungsi lain, maka prototype fungsi harus dideklarasikan diatas program utama.
4. Program Utama
Program utama berisi statemen-statemen yang akan memanggil fungsi-fungsi lain.
Artikel ini adalah buku ajar dosen saya suhu Misbahudin selengkapnya bisa d download
disini
Home » Archive for November 2008
Struct / struktur pada C++
7.STRUKTUR
Struktur bermanfaat untuk mengelompokkan sejumlah data dengan tipe yang
berlainan9:Perhatikan:contoh:struktur:berikut:ini7
struct data_tanggal
{
int tahun;
int bulan;
int tanggal;
};
Struktur di atas bernama data_tanggalf yang tersusun atas B unit penyusunnya
yaitu tahunf tanggalf dan bulan9 Setelah dibuat struktur tanggalf selanjutnya
struktur tersebut dapat digunakan sebagai tipe data suatu variabelf dalam hal ini
disebut tipe data abstrak
Disini nantinya juga akan dianalisa sebuah program secara detail, yakni dibahas perbaris
dari script program
materi selngkapnya dapat didownload disni
sekian wasalam
Struktur bermanfaat untuk mengelompokkan sejumlah data dengan tipe yang
berlainan9:Perhatikan:contoh:struktur:berikut:ini7
struct data_tanggal
{
int tahun;
int bulan;
int tanggal;
};
Struktur di atas bernama data_tanggalf yang tersusun atas B unit penyusunnya
yaitu tahunf tanggalf dan bulan9 Setelah dibuat struktur tanggalf selanjutnya
struktur tersebut dapat digunakan sebagai tipe data suatu variabelf dalam hal ini
disebut tipe data abstrak
Disini nantinya juga akan dianalisa sebuah program secara detail, yakni dibahas perbaris
dari script program
materi selngkapnya dapat didownload disni
sekian wasalam
Posted by Unknown
,
Add Comment
Oprasi File pada C++
Pada pertemuan kali ini akan dibahas oprasi I/O ke file
JENIS FILE
Jenis File terdiri dari dua yaitu:
1. File Teks
File teks adalah file yang berisikan kumpulan karakter ASCII yang disusun
menjadi beberapa baris, dimana setiap baris diakhiri dengan tanda akhir
baris (“\n”).
2. File Biner
File biner adalah file yang berisikan data yang masing-masing elemen
berupa data 8 bit (1 byte). Jenis file ini biasanya menggunakan kode-kode
yang tidak dapat dimengerti, sehingga file ini cocok digunakan untuk data-
data rahasia.
Operasi File
Operasi file adalah proses input/baca dari file dan proses output/tulis ke
file. Untuk melakukan operasi input file digunakan objek ifstream dan untuk
operasi output file digunakan objek ofstream. Kedua objek tersebut berada
pada header file fstream.h.
selengkapnya bisa diownload disini
JENIS FILE
Jenis File terdiri dari dua yaitu:
1. File Teks
File teks adalah file yang berisikan kumpulan karakter ASCII yang disusun
menjadi beberapa baris, dimana setiap baris diakhiri dengan tanda akhir
baris (“\n”).
2. File Biner
File biner adalah file yang berisikan data yang masing-masing elemen
berupa data 8 bit (1 byte). Jenis file ini biasanya menggunakan kode-kode
yang tidak dapat dimengerti, sehingga file ini cocok digunakan untuk data-
data rahasia.
Operasi File
Operasi file adalah proses input/baca dari file dan proses output/tulis ke
file. Untuk melakukan operasi input file digunakan objek ifstream dan untuk
operasi output file digunakan objek ofstream. Kedua objek tersebut berada
pada header file fstream.h.
selengkapnya bisa diownload disini
Posted by Unknown
,
Add Comment
Array pada C++
Bagi anda yang sudah paham dengan materi sebelumnyayakni tentang
pointer, akan sangat membantu anda dalam mempelajari array secara lebih dalam. Array boleh juga dikatakanlumayan rumit. dalam materi ini akan banyak juga digunakan Looping, materi tentang looping sendiri sudah dibahas seblumnya bagi yang ingin membaca atau mungkin ingin menambah referensi bisa dibaca di sini
Array adalah kumpulan dari nilai-nilai data yang bertipe sama dalam
urutan tertentu yang menggunakan sebuah nama yang sama. Nilai-nilai data
dari di suatu array disebut elemen-elemen array. Letak urutan dari suatu
elemen array ditunjukkan oleh suatu indeks Array dapat berdimensi, satu, dua, tiga atau lebih. Bentuk dimensi array
berupa: Dimensi satu (one-dimensional array) mewakili bentuk vektor Dimensi dua (two-dimensional array) mewakili bentuk dari suatu matriks atau tabel Dimensi tiga (three-dimensional array) mewakili bentuk ruang. Untuk penjelasan secara lebih detailnya artikelnya bisa diowload disini
demikian semoga yang sedikit ini bisa menjadi berkah bagi kita
wasalam
ingin berdiskusi bisa hubungi saya disni hsopian7@gamil.com
pointer, akan sangat membantu anda dalam mempelajari array secara lebih dalam. Array boleh juga dikatakanlumayan rumit. dalam materi ini akan banyak juga digunakan Looping, materi tentang looping sendiri sudah dibahas seblumnya bagi yang ingin membaca atau mungkin ingin menambah referensi bisa dibaca di sini
Array adalah kumpulan dari nilai-nilai data yang bertipe sama dalam
urutan tertentu yang menggunakan sebuah nama yang sama. Nilai-nilai data
dari di suatu array disebut elemen-elemen array. Letak urutan dari suatu
elemen array ditunjukkan oleh suatu indeks Array dapat berdimensi, satu, dua, tiga atau lebih. Bentuk dimensi array
berupa: Dimensi satu (one-dimensional array) mewakili bentuk vektor Dimensi dua (two-dimensional array) mewakili bentuk dari suatu matriks atau tabel Dimensi tiga (three-dimensional array) mewakili bentuk ruang. Untuk penjelasan secara lebih detailnya artikelnya bisa diowload disini
demikian semoga yang sedikit ini bisa menjadi berkah bagi kita
wasalam
ingin berdiskusi bisa hubungi saya disni hsopian7@gamil.com
Posted by Unknown
,
Add Comment
Pointer dalam C++
Kali ini kta membahas pointer pada C++, bisa dibilang pointer ini agak sedikit rumit dibandingkan dibandingkan dengan materi-materi yang telah kita bahas sebelumnya, oleh karna itu sebaiknya materi-materi yang sudah kita bahas seblumnya dipahami dengan baik. Bagi yang belum membaca artikel sebelumnya bisa dibaca di siniPointer adalah suatu variable yang berisi alamat memory sebagai nilainya dan berbeda dengan variable biasa yang berisi nilai tertentu. Dengan kata lain, pointer berisi alamat dari variable yang mempunyai nilai tertentu Dengan mempelajari materi ini nantinya kita
dapat memahami definisi dan kegunaan pointer dan dapat mengetahui bagaimana mengimplentasikan pointer dalam program. Dalam materi ini nantinya juga akan dibahas sebuah program secara mendetail yakni perbaris program.
materi selengkapnya bisa didownload disini
semoga bermanfaat
wasalam
jika ada suatu hal yang ingin didiskusikan bisa hungi saya lewat email ini
hsopian7@gamil.com
dapat memahami definisi dan kegunaan pointer dan dapat mengetahui bagaimana mengimplentasikan pointer dalam program. Dalam materi ini nantinya juga akan dibahas sebuah program secara mendetail yakni perbaris program.
materi selengkapnya bisa didownload disini
semoga bermanfaat
wasalam
jika ada suatu hal yang ingin didiskusikan bisa hungi saya lewat email ini
hsopian7@gamil.com
Posted by Unknown
,
Add Comment
FUNGSI / FUNCTION dalam C++
Ketemu lagi...
eh udah baca artikel sebelumnya gak
kalau belum sebaiknya dibaca dan dipahami dulu, sama doung seperti cinta, dari pandangan dulu, trus bicara, dan akhirnya berbekas dah dihati
Oceh..pada pertemuan kali ini akan dibahas tentang penguunaan fungsi pada pemrograman C++. tentunya fungsi pada pemrograman C++ tidak jauh beda dengan fungsi pada pemrograman lainnya dengan mempelajari fungsi ini, natinya kita diharapkan bisa Mahasiswa mengenal function dalam bahasa C / C++ dan bisa membuat program procedural dengan bahasa C / C++.
Arikelnya bisa didownload selengkapnya di sini
Sekian dulu, semoga saja apa yang kita bagi-bagi hari ini bisa menjadi penuntun
kita menuju kesuksesan
wasalam
hsopian7@gamil.com
eh udah baca artikel sebelumnya gak
kalau belum sebaiknya dibaca dan dipahami dulu, sama doung seperti cinta, dari pandangan dulu, trus bicara, dan akhirnya berbekas dah dihati
Oceh..pada pertemuan kali ini akan dibahas tentang penguunaan fungsi pada pemrograman C++. tentunya fungsi pada pemrograman C++ tidak jauh beda dengan fungsi pada pemrograman lainnya dengan mempelajari fungsi ini, natinya kita diharapkan bisa Mahasiswa mengenal function dalam bahasa C / C++ dan bisa membuat program procedural dengan bahasa C / C++.
Arikelnya bisa didownload selengkapnya di sini
Sekian dulu, semoga saja apa yang kita bagi-bagi hari ini bisa menjadi penuntun
kita menuju kesuksesan
wasalam
hsopian7@gamil.com
Posted by Unknown
,
Add Comment
Statement control dan Looping pada C++
wait....
sebelum anda mempelajari statement control dan looping ini, alangkah lebih baiknya
bagi anda yang belum membaca penjelasan seblumnya yakni tentang dasar-dasar pemrograman C++ dianjurkan mempelajarinya terlebih dahulu,
karna bagaimanapun juga dalam mempelajari sebuah bahasa pemrograman, selain membekali diri dengan alogaritma yang kuat kita juga sebaiknya harus mempelajari dasarnya dengan baik.
Kali ini kita akan coba membahas tentang statement control dan looping dalam pemrograman C++,dimana nantinya kita akan mempelajri penggunaan statement control yakni if, else if, if else if dan switch-case, dan untuk loopingnya akan dipelajari penggunaan perulangan for, while dan do-while.
Bagi anda yang sudah belajar bahasa java, tidak akan menemui kesulitan dalam mempelajari statement control dan looping dalam pemrograman C++, karna boleh dikatakan sintaknya hampir sama.
Disini juga nantinya akan disertai dengan script sebuah program yang akan dijelaskan secara detail, yakni setiap baris dari script program akan dibahas. Jadi dengan mengikuti penjelasan ini nantinay diharapkan kita bisa lebih memahami tentang statement control dan looping pada pemrograman C+
Selengkapnya bisa di download di disini
sekian mudahan bisa bermanfaat bagi kita semua
wasalam
sebelum anda mempelajari statement control dan looping ini, alangkah lebih baiknya
bagi anda yang belum membaca penjelasan seblumnya yakni tentang dasar-dasar pemrograman C++ dianjurkan mempelajarinya terlebih dahulu,
karna bagaimanapun juga dalam mempelajari sebuah bahasa pemrograman, selain membekali diri dengan alogaritma yang kuat kita juga sebaiknya harus mempelajari dasarnya dengan baik.
Kali ini kita akan coba membahas tentang statement control dan looping dalam pemrograman C++,dimana nantinya kita akan mempelajri penggunaan statement control yakni if, else if, if else if dan switch-case, dan untuk loopingnya akan dipelajari penggunaan perulangan for, while dan do-while.
Bagi anda yang sudah belajar bahasa java, tidak akan menemui kesulitan dalam mempelajari statement control dan looping dalam pemrograman C++, karna boleh dikatakan sintaknya hampir sama.
Disini juga nantinya akan disertai dengan script sebuah program yang akan dijelaskan secara detail, yakni setiap baris dari script program akan dibahas. Jadi dengan mengikuti penjelasan ini nantinay diharapkan kita bisa lebih memahami tentang statement control dan looping pada pemrograman C+
Selengkapnya bisa di download di disini
sekian mudahan bisa bermanfaat bagi kita semua
wasalam
Posted by Unknown
,
Add Comment
Dasar-dasar pemrograman c++
Dalam artikel ini akan dibahas dasar-dasar pada pemrograman c++, mulai dari pengenalan jenis-jenis operator yang digunakan dalam pemrograman c++, struktur pemrograman C++,
dan type-type data data yang digunakan. Dalam bab ini juga akan dibahas tentang bagaimana menginputkan data dari keyboard dan menampilkannya pada layar. Saya sangat yakin setelah anda membaca pejelasannya nanti anda akan mendapatkan gambaran yang jelas tentang pemrograman C++
Tanpa berbanyak kata lagi, artikelnya bisa didownload dan dipelajari disni. Dalam artikel ini nantinya akan
dipaparkan contoh sebuah program yang disertai dengan penjelasan detail bari perbari dari script program, so mari kita sama=sama belajar
Oceh sekian dulu, smoga apa yang kita beri akan membuka jalan kita untuk masa depan.
wasalam
dan type-type data data yang digunakan. Dalam bab ini juga akan dibahas tentang bagaimana menginputkan data dari keyboard dan menampilkannya pada layar. Saya sangat yakin setelah anda membaca pejelasannya nanti anda akan mendapatkan gambaran yang jelas tentang pemrograman C++
Tanpa berbanyak kata lagi, artikelnya bisa didownload dan dipelajari disni. Dalam artikel ini nantinya akan
dipaparkan contoh sebuah program yang disertai dengan penjelasan detail bari perbari dari script program, so mari kita sama=sama belajar
Oceh sekian dulu, smoga apa yang kita beri akan membuka jalan kita untuk masa depan.
wasalam
Posted by Unknown
,
Add Comment
Subscribe to:
Posts (Atom)